The Importance of Accurate and Effective Nursing Documentation Nursing documentation is a critical aspect of patient care, playing a key role in the treatment process. Accurate documentation is essential for a variety of reasons, including: Legal and Ethical Accountability: Proper documentation serves as a legal record of the care provided, which can be essential in case of disputes or legal proceedings. It also ensures that nurses meet ethical standards and provide accountable care. Patient Safety: Clear and accurate records reduce the risk of medical errors, miscommunication, and misunderstanding between healthcare professionals, thereby enhancing patient safety. Continuity of Care: Well-documented care plans, progress nurs fpx 4035 assessment 2 notes, and interventions ensure that all members of the healthcare team have access to up-to-date information, promoting effective collaboration and continuity of care. Quality of Care: Effective documentation supports evidence-based practice, facilitates patient monitoring, and contributes to the development of care protocols and standards. Given these reasons, the ability to create comprehensive, precise, and well-organized nursing documentation is a skill that every nurse must cultivate.
